Overview of RSMSSB Livestock Assistant Exam 2024
The Rajasthan Subordinate and Ministerial Services Selection Board (RSMSSB) conducts the Livestock Assistant Recruitment Exam to fill vacancies in the Animal Husbandry Department of the Rajasthan Government. This exam is a golden opportunity for candidates aspiring to secure a government job in Rajasthan’s animal husbandry sector. The recruitment is governed by the Rajasthan Animal Husbandry Subordinate Service Rules, 1977 (as amended) and the Rajasthan Scheduled Areas Subordinate, Ministerial, and Class IV Service (Recruitment and Other Service Conditions) Rules, 2014.
The role of a Livestock Assistant involves assisting veterinarians, managing livestock health, and implementing animal husbandry programs at the grassroots level. This position is critical for enhancing livestock productivity and supporting rural livelihoods in Rajasthan.

Eligibility Criteria
Nationality
Candidates must be:
- A citizen of India, or
- A subject of Nepal/Bhutan, or
- A Tibetan refugee who came to India before 1 January 1962 with the intention of permanent settlement, or
- A person of Indian origin who has migrated from Pakistan, Myanmar, Sri Lanka, Kenya, Uganda, Tanzania, Zambia, Malawi, Zaire, Ethiopia, or Vietnam with the intention of permanent settlement in India.
Note: Candidates falling under categories (b), (c), and (d) must possess an eligibility certificate issued by the Government of India.
Age Limit (as on 01 January 2026)
- Minimum Age: 18 years
- Maximum Age: 40 years
Age Relaxation
| Category | Relaxation (Years) |
|---|---|
| General Category Women | 5 |
| SC/ST/OBC/MBC/EWS (Male, Rajasthan) | 5 |
| SC/ST/OBC/MBC/EWS (Female, Rajasthan) | 10 |
| Widows and Divorced Women | No upper age limit* |
| Persons with Disabilities (PwD) | 5 (additional) |
| Ex-Servicemen | As per government norms |
| Emergency Commissioned Officers | As per government norms |
Note: Widows and divorced women must not exceed the state government’s retirement age (60 years).
Educational Qualifications
Candidates must possess:
- Senior Secondary (10+2) from a recognized board with the following subjects:
- Physics, Chemistry, and Biology, or
- Agriculture, Agriculture Biology/Biology, and Physics/Chemistry/Agriculture Chemistry.
- One of the following:
- One-year Training Certificate in Livestock Assistant, or
- Two-year Training Certificate/Diploma in Livestock Assistant from an institution recognized by the Government of Rajasthan.
- Working knowledge of Hindi written in Devanagari script and any one Rajasthani dialect.
Note: Candidates appearing for the final year of the qualifying examination are eligible to apply but must submit proof of qualification before the specified stages of the selection process.
Other Requirements
- Character: Candidates must possess a good character certificate from their last educational institution or two responsible non-relatives.
- Health: Candidates must be mentally and physically fit, free from any defect that may hinder their duties. A medical fitness certificate from the Chief Medical Officer of the district is required post-selection.
- Marriage Registration: Marriage registration is mandatory for appointment as per government norms.

Exam Pattern and Syllabus
RSMSSB Livestock Assistant Exam Pattern
| Section | Number of Questions | Marks | Duration |
|---|---|---|---|
| Part A: General Studies | 50 | 150 | 3 Hours |
| Part B: Veterinary Science | 100 | ||
| Total | 150 | 150 | 3 Hours |
Note:
- The exam will be objective-type (multiple-choice questions).
- Each question carries 1 mark.
- Negative marking: 1/3 mark will be deducted for each incorrect answer.
- Minimum qualifying marks: 40% (35% for SC/ST candidates).
Syllabus for RSMSSB Livestock Assistant Exam
Part A: General Studies
-
History, Art, Culture, Literature, Tradition, and Heritage of Rajasthan
- Ancient civilizations (Kalibangan, Ahar, Ganeshwar, Balathal, Bairath).
- Major dynasties and their administrative systems.
- Architecture, art, paintings, and handicrafts.
- Freedom movement and integration of Rajasthan.
- Folk languages, literature, music, dance, saints, and folk deities.
- Fairs, festivals, customs, attire, and jewelry.
-
Geography of Rajasthan
- Physical features, climate, vegetation, and soils.
- Rivers, dams, lakes, and natural resources.
- Population, tribes, and tourism.
-
Indian Political System with Special Emphasis on Rajasthan
- Constitution of India: Preamble, Fundamental Rights, Directive Principles, and Fundamental Duties.
- State governance: Governor, Chief Minister, State Legislature, High Court, and state commissions.
- Local self-government and Panchayati Raj.
-
Economy of Rajasthan
- Agriculture, irrigation projects, and drought management.
- Welfare schemes and rural development.
-
Everyday Science
- Physical and chemical changes, oxidation, and catalysts.
- Metals, non-metals, and important compounds.
- Carbon and its compounds, polymers, and soaps.
- Reflection and refraction of light, lenses, and vision defects.
- Space and information technology.
- Genetics, ecosystems, and biotechnology.
- Economic importance of plants and animals.
- Blood groups, diseases, and malnutrition.
-
Computer Knowledge
- Characteristics of computers.
- Computer organization (RAM, ROM, file systems).
- Input/output devices.
- MS Office (Word, Excel, PowerPoint).
-
Current Affairs
- Major national and international events.
- Sports and games.
- Persons, places, and institutions in the news.
Part B: Veterinary Science
- Introductory Veterinary Anatomy
- Introductory Veterinary Physiology and Biochemistry
- Animal Husbandry Extension
- Introductory Veterinary Medicine
- Minor Veterinary Surgery
- Introductory Animal Nutrition
- Introductory Animal Management
- Introductory Animal Breeding and Genetics
- Introductory Animal Reproduction
- Introductory Veterinary Pharmacology
